Types of Flood Barriers I Considered

I found that flood barriers come in several forms, and each one works best in different situations:

  • Temporary barriers: These are easy to store and set up when needed. I liked them for short-term protection.
  • Permanent barriers: These stay in place and are designed for repeated use. I found them useful for homes in high-risk areas.
  • Inflatable barriers: These are lightweight and can be filled with air or water. I liked the convenience, but I knew they needed proper maintenance.
  • Sandbag alternatives: These are modern options that are often quicker and cleaner to use than traditional sandbags.

What I Looked for Before Buying

Before I made a purchase, I focused on a few important factors:

  • Flood risk level: I checked how much water my area usually gets and how often flooding happens.
  • Ease of installation: I wanted a barrier I could set up without needing special tools or a large crew.
  • Durability: I looked for materials that could handle strong water pressure and repeated use.
  • Storage: Since space matters at home, I preferred a barrier that was compact when not in use.
  • Coverage: I made sure the barrier could protect the exact entry points I was worried about.

Installation and Maintenance

I learned that even the best flood barrier will not help much if it is hard to install or poorly maintained. I always checked whether the product came with clear instructions and whether I could test it before an emergency. I also made sure I understood how to clean, dry, and store it properly after use so it would be ready next time.
